✨ Remember the first time you got that thing you prayed so hard for? The new job, the apartment, the breakthrough? We were overflowing with gratitude. But somewhere along the way, we stop appreciating what we have and started chasing the next shiny thing.
✨ Psychologists call this the hedonic treadmill—which is our tendency to return to a baseline level of happiness no matter what we achieve.
✨ Lately, I’ve been frustrated with myself about this. I can’t just exist; I always have to be striving. Always asking: what’s next?
✨ When do we find true contentment and practice real gratitude for what God has already done? I don’t have the answers yet, but I’m sitting with this question.
